On Sat, 29 Nov 1997, Gerben 'Xylo' Castel wrote:> Hello, > I'd like to know if there's a way to receive Workgroup's winpopup messages > with samba under linux. > If it's impossible, what are the technical problems caused by such a request ? > > Thank youyes, i see no reason why you shouldn't process such messages. have a look in client.c::send_message() and see if smbd (reply.c) already deals with these messages. if not, then you should be able to copy some code in reply.c and decode the SMBs that send_message() sends. luke <a href="mailto:lkcl@switchboard.net" > Luke Kenneth Casson Leighton </a> <a href="http://mailhost.cb1.com/~lkcl"> Samba Consultancy and Support </a>
